Dana Airline has now formally joined Air Peace and Ibom Air in daily flight operations into Enugu State from Lagos and Abuja, Igbere TV reports.

This was disclosed by the Airline's Chief Operating Officer, Obi Mbanuzuo, who led the management team on a visit to Governor Ifeanyi Ugwuanyi at the Government House, Enugu, on Monday.

He said the decision to commence operations in the state was because, “Enugu has shown to be one of the most peaceful states in Nigeria where the economy is growing and Dana Air wants to contribute to the growth of the economy”.

The Enugu State government has commenced immediate mass vaccination for Yellow Fever in Ette and Umuopu communities in Igbo-Eze North Local Government Area of the state.

Igbere TV reports that this is following the confirmation of the outbreak of the disease in the aforementioned areas.

The state government has also commenced the immediate fumigation of the affected communities against the mosquito vector with the appropriate chemicals.

This is even as government, in a statement forwarded to Igbere TV, announced the “activation of the Enugu State Ministry of Health Emergency Operations Centre for Yellow Fever”.

Signed by the Commissioner for Health, Dr. Emmanuel Ikechukwu Obi, the state government disclosed that it has begun Active Case Surveillance to obtain necessary information on the epidemic for further decision making.

A medical team from the State Ministry of Health, led by the Health Commissioner, Dr. Obi and Officers of the Enugu State Fire Service, also led by the Chief Fire Officer, Engr. Okwudiri Ohaa, were in the affected communities, on Wednesday, to commence vaccination and fumigation exercises, respectively.

Dr. Obi added that the government has prepositioned General Hospital Ogrute Enugu-Ezike, commenced treatment with Ambulance Service for emergency and “constitution of the Enugu State Multi-Sectorial Technical Working Group for the Yellow Fever Epidemic”.

The Health Commissioner pointed out that the state government has embarked on risk communication in the affected communities, and has formally notified “the Federal Ministry of Health, Nigerian Centre for Disease Control (NCDC), National Primary Health Care Development Agency (NPHCDA), and the National Arbovirus and Vectors Research Centre for a sustained response since Yellow Fever has also been reported in other states in Nigeria”.

Disclosing that the measures were in compliance with the directives of Governor Ifeanyi Ugwuanyi of Enugu State and in line with laid down guidelines to combat such epidemic, Dr. Obi said: “We thank the Traditional Rulers, Religious Leaders, Presidents General of Town Unions, other stakeholders and the good people of Enugu State who have in so many ways contributed to this expedited response to the epidemic in Enugu State”.

He therefore advised the public that: “If you have been recently vaccinated against Yellow Fever, you do not need to be vaccinated again. Yellow Fever is transmitted through mosquito bites, thus remove its breeding sites around you. If you are not feeling well, please visit a nearby hospital.”

The relative peace being enjoyed in the 9th Senate under the leadership of Ahmed Lawan may soon be short lived as trouble appears to be brewing in the Senate; over the leadership style of some standing committee Chairmen of the Red Chambers as members have expressed their complaints over what they described as the high handedness of the Chairmen in running the commitee affairs. 

According to members,  some of the committee Chairmen were living like "Lords" and have left a vast majority of them disenfranchised.

Competent knowledgeable sources said the Chairmen of the said committees have debarred majority of the members of the committees from carrying out their duties by refusing to carry them along with the committee's activities.

They also vowed to commence impeachment proceedings against the said committee Chairmen if the Senate President does not replace the Chairmen to avert the huge looming crisis, which according to them will mark the beginning of crisis in the 9th Senate.

The alleged commitees are: Army led by Senator Ali Ndume (Borno South), Customs, Excise and Tariff led by Senator Francis Alimikhena (Edo North), Banking and Finance led by Senator Uba Sani (Kaduna Central), Police Affairs led by Senator Haliru Jika (Bauchi Central), Upstream petroleum led by Senator Albert Bassey Akpan (Akwa Ibom North-East), and Marine led by Senator Danjuma Goje (Gombe Central).

Expressing their grievances they accused the chairmen of solely running the affairs of the committee, turning deaf ears to the series of complaints laid by members and refusal to reach out to them.

They warned that the Senate risks a huge crisis explosion if the nothing is done address ugly trend. 

One of the sources said: “it's unfortunate that these Chairmen are living like "Lords" since their inauguration, they rarely call for meetings most of us don't even know what is going on in the commitees. Now that budget defense is on-going no meeting has been called for us as members to sit and discuss on areas to focus, so how are we expected to scrutinize these Federal agencies when they appear for budget defense? Things can't continue this way if the Senate does not intervene we shall be left with no other option than to impeach the Chairmen.”

Although some of the members revealed that they have made efforts to reach out to the Chairmen but they have made themselves unreachable and in most cases refused to heed to their appeals. 

"Yes we are loyal to the Senate President but we can't continue to suffer in silence and allow our constitutional roles to be undermined. The Chairmen seem to have forgotten that they can be removed maybe that it is why we are being underrated. Our nation is faced with so many challenges and these commitees is an opportunity to address those challenges. We need Chairmen who are team players,” said the source.

Another competent source in the National Assembly confirmed plans by members of the commitee to impeach the Chairmen if the Senate President decline to reshuffle the Chairmen.
